================================================================== BUG: KCSAN: data-race in ondemand_readahead / page_cache_ra_order write to 0xffff88813d3c5984 of 4 bytes by task 4682 on cpu 0: ondemand_readahead+0x364/0x690 page_cache_async_ra+0x94/0xa0 mm/readahead.c:717 do_async_mmap_readahead mm/filemap.c:3227 [inline] filemap_fault+0x3a0/0xbf0 mm/filemap.c:3281 __do_fault mm/memory.c:4207 [inline] do_read_fault mm/memory.c:4571 [inline] do_fault mm/memory.c:4708 [inline] do_pte_missing mm/memory.c:3672 [inline] handle_pte_fault mm/memory.c:4981 [inline] __handle_mm_fault mm/memory.c:5122 [inline] handle_mm_fault+0x15e2/0x2cc0 mm/memory.c:5287 faultin_page mm/gup.c:956 [inline] __get_user_pages+0x402/0xe40 mm/gup.c:1239 populate_vma_page_range mm/gup.c:1666 [inline] __mm_populate+0x216/0x330 mm/gup.c:1775 mm_populate include/linux/mm.h:3305 [inline] vm_mmap_pgoff+0x1a7/0x240 mm/util.c:551 ksys_mmap_pgoff+0x2b8/0x330 mm/mmap.c:1420 do_syscall_x64 arch/x86/entry/common.c:50 [inline] do_syscall_64+0x41/0xc0 arch/x86/entry/common.c:80 entry_SYSCALL_64_after_hwframe+0x63/0xcd read to 0xffff88813d3c5984 of 4 bytes by task 4675 on cpu 1: page_cache_ra_order+0x5a/0xf0 mm/readahead.c:546 do_sync_mmap_readahead+0x410/0x450 mm/filemap.c:3199 filemap_fault+0x3e6/0xbf0 mm/filemap.c:3291 __do_fault mm/memory.c:4207 [inline] do_shared_fault mm/memory.c:4638 [inline] do_fault mm/memory.c:4712 [inline] do_pte_missing mm/memory.c:3672 [inline] handle_pte_fault mm/memory.c:4981 [inline] __handle_mm_fault mm/memory.c:5122 [inline] handle_mm_fault+0x170f/0x2cc0 mm/memory.c:5287 do_user_addr_fault arch/x86/mm/fault.c:1413 [inline] handle_page_fault arch/x86/mm/fault.c:1505 [inline] exc_page_fault+0x2f7/0x6c0 arch/x86/mm/fault.c:1561 asm_exc_page_fault+0x26/0x30 arch/x86/include/asm/idtentry.h:570 value changed: 0x00000008 -> 0x00000020 Reported by Kernel Concurrency Sanitizer on: CPU: 1 PID: 4675 Comm: syz-executor.4 Not tainted 6.6.0-syzkaller-00207-g14ab6d425e80 #0 Hardware name: Google Google Compute Engine/Google Compute Engine, BIOS Google 10/09/2023 ==================================================================